Fruits are high in fiber. Fiber makes you feel full, so you eat less. For instance, a diet rich in berries, which are high in fiber, can keep you satisfied for longer periods. Also, the water content in fruits is high. This helps in flushing out toxins from the body and aids digestion. When your digestion is good, your body can process food more efficiently, which is beneficial for weight loss. Moreover, the natural sugars in fruits provide energy without adding a lot of fat or empty calories like processed sugars do.
